IDM Auth Client

HTTP client library for IDM authentication and authorization.

Installation

npm install @idm-auth/auth-client

Quick Start

This library requires you to provide an HTTP client implementation. You can use the built-in FetchHttpClient or create your own.

Using Built-in FetchHttpClient

import { validateAuthentication, FetchHttpClient } from '@idm-auth/auth-client';

const httpClient = new FetchHttpClient(5000); // 5 second timeout

const result = await validateAuthentication(
  httpClient,
  'https://idm-auth.example.com',
  {
    application: 'my-app',
    token: 'jwt.token.here',
    tenantId: 'tenant-123',
  }
);

if (result.valid) {
  console.log('Authenticated:', result.valid);
} else {
  console.error('Authentication failed:', result.error);
}

Using Custom HTTP Client (Axios)

import {
  validateAuthentication,
  authorize,
  IHttpClient,
  HttpOptions,
} from '@idm-auth/auth-client';
import axios from 'axios';

class AxiosHttpClient implements IHttpClient {
  private axiosInstance;

  constructor(timeout = 5000) {
    this.axiosInstance = axios.create({ timeout });
  }

  async post<T>(url: string, data: unknown, options?: HttpOptions): Promise<T> {
    const response = await this.axiosInstance.post(url, data, {
      headers: options?.headers,
    });
    return response.data;
  }

  async get<T>(url: string, options?: HttpOptions): Promise<T> {
    const response = await this.axiosInstance.get(url, {
      headers: options?.headers,
    });
    return response.data;
  }
}

const httpClient = new AxiosHttpClient(10000); // 10 second timeout

const authResult = await validateAuthentication(
  httpClient,
  'https://idm-auth.example.com',
  {
    application: 'my-app',
    token: 'jwt.token.here',
    tenantId: 'tenant-123',
  }
);

const authzResult = await authorize(
  httpClient,
  'https://idm-auth.example.com',
  {
    application: 'my-app',
    accountId: 'account-123',
    tenantId: 'tenant-123',
    action: 'iam:accounts:read',
    resource: 'grn:global:iam::tenant-123:accounts/*',
  }
);

HTTP Client Interface

You must implement the IHttpClient interface:

export interface IHttpClient {
  post<T>(url: string, data: unknown, options?: HttpOptions): Promise<T>;
  get<T>(url: string, options?: HttpOptions): Promise<T>;
}

export interface HttpOptions {
  headers?: Record<string, string>;
}

The library will pass required headers (like Content-Type and X-IDM-Application) through the options parameter. Your implementation should merge these with any custom headers you want to add.

API

validateAuthentication(httpClient, idmUrl, request)

Validates authentication token with IDM backend.

Why validate remotely? Even if a JWT token is technically valid (correct signature, not expired), the IDM backend performs additional contextual validations:

  • Account status (active, blocked, deleted)
  • Session validity (not revoked)
  • IP address validation (optional)
  • User-Agent validation (optional)
  • Permission changes since token was issued

Parameters:

  • httpClient (IHttpClient): HTTP client implementation
  • idmUrl (string): IDM API base URL
  • request (AuthenticationValidationRequest):
    • application (string): Application identifier
    • token (string): Authentication token (JWT, API Key, OAuth token, etc)
    • tenantId (string): Tenant context

Returns: Promise<AuthenticationValidationResponse>

  • valid (boolean): Whether authentication is valid
  • user? (UserPayload): User data if valid
    • accountId (string): User account ID
    • email (string): User email
    • roles? (string[]): User roles
    • permissions? (string[]): User permissions
  • error? (string): Error message if invalid

authorize(httpClient, idmUrl, request)

Checks authorization with IDM.

Parameters:

  • httpClient (IHttpClient): HTTP client implementation
  • idmUrl (string): IDM API base URL
  • request (AuthorizationRequest):
    • application (string): Application identifier
    • accountId (string): User account ID
    • tenantId (string): Tenant context
    • partition? (string): Partition (default: 'global')
    • region? (string): Region
    • action (string): Action format: {system}:{resource}:{operation}
    • resource (string): GRN format resource

Returns: Promise<AuthorizationResponse>

  • allowed (boolean): Whether action is authorized
  • payload? (object): Additional data
  • error? (string): Error message if denied

Customization

Your HTTP client implementation can add:

  • Custom timeout values
  • Retry logic
  • Request/response interceptors
  • Custom headers (API keys, authentication)
  • Logging
  • Error handling

The library handles:

  • Correct API endpoints
  • Required headers
  • Request/response structure
  • Telemetry tracing
